Uyarı: Bu sayfa otomatik (makine) bir çeviridir, herhangi bir şüpheniz olması durumunda lütfen orijinal İngilizce belgeye bakın. Bunun neden olabileceği rahatsızlıktan dolayı özür dileriz.

ECTkeyboard - Kişiselleştirilmiş sanal klavye oluşturma

Kişiselleştirilmiş sanal klavye oluşturma

ECTkeyboard inanılmaz esnek ayar özellikleri sağlar. Örneğin, kullanıcı, her bir düğme için özelleştirilmiş başlıklar ve görüntü veya ses ekleme dahil olmak üzere, herhangi bir miktarda veya konumdaki düğme ile kendi sanal klavyesini oluşturabilir. Bunu yapabilmek için kullanıcının düğme başlıkları ve görüntülere veya seslere giden tam yolları olan bir klavye dosyası oluşturması gerekir. Programın böyle bir dosyayla çalışacak şekilde ayarlanması da gereklidir.

Klavye dosyaları

Klavye dosyaları, özel bir ayırma sembolü kullanılarak yazılmış parametreleri içeren metin dosyalarıdır (varsayılan değer #'dır). Dosyadaki her dize, sanal klavyedeki bir düğmeye karşılık gelir; sanal klavyede dokuz düğme varsa, klavyenin dosyasında dokuz bağımsız dize bulunmalıdır.

Sanal klavye dosyası örneğine bakalım (bkz. Şekil 23).

Keyboard file example (Şek. 23. Klavye dosyası örneği)

Bu klavye özellikle tıp ve rehabilitasyon merkezleri için oluşturuldu ve ana görevi konuşamayan veya yazamayan bir hastayla ilk ilk teması kurmak. Klavye sadece dokuz tuş içermektedir: 'Yemek', 'İçki', 'Tuvalet', 'Sıcak', 'Soğuk', 'Uyku', 'İyi', 'Kötü', 'Ağrı'.

Bu örnek, dosyanın her dizesinin çeşitli parametreleri ayarlamak için nasıl kullanıldığını gösterir. Daha net hale getirmek için, dosya içeriği birkaç sütuna bölünebilir.

Clear structure of the keyboard file (Şek. 24. Klavye dosyasının yapısını temizleyin)

Klavye dosyası yapısı, her bir satır sanal klavyedeki bir düğmeye karşılık gelirken, her sütun düğmenin farklı bir parametresine karşılık gelen bir tabloyla karşılaştırılabilir.

Sütun numaraları 0'dan başlar. Söz konusu örnekte:

Programın klavye dosyasıyla çalışacak şekilde ayarlanması

Programı çalıştırmak için bir klavye dosyası oluşturmak yeterli değildir. Kullanıcı kurmak zorunda ECTkeyboard Programın uygun işlevselliğini sağlamak için. Bunu yapabilmek için, kullanıcının programın ayarlar penceresinde aşağıdaki parametreleri değiştirmesi gerekir:

Programdaki tüm değişiklikleri kaydettikten sonra, kullanıcının seçicinin uygun bir çalışma modunu seçmesi gerekir. Program çalışmaya hazır (bkz. Şek. 25). Böyle bir klavye için en uygun çalışma yöntemi ikinci yöntemdir, yani yatay tarama modu.

Appearance of simplified keyboard with icons (Şek. 25. Simgeli basitleştirilmiş klavyenin görünümü)

PROEk bilgi

İlk sürümleri ECTkeyboard sanal klavye başlıkları, resimler ve sesler için ayrı dosyalar seçme imkanı vardı (programın ayarlar penceresinin 6, 7, 8 parametreleri). Ancak en son sürümün yayınlanmasından sonra, belirtilen tüm parametreler klavye dosyalarında birleştirildi. Böylece parametre 7 ve 8 programın ayar penceresinden gizlenir.

Sanal klavyenin her düğmesine bir resim yazısı, en fazla 5 farklı görüntü (etkin olmayan durum, imlecin altındaki bir düğme, düğme satırı seçimi, düğme seçimi, basılan düğme) ve düğme vurgulandığında çalınan bir ses dosyası atanabilir . Bahsedilen parametrelerin tümü zorunlu değildir; kullanıcı yalnızca bir düğme grubu için sesleri ve simgeleri ve yalnızca başka bir grup için altyazıları seçebilir. Bir düğme için parametre olmasa bile, ECTkeyboard hala düzgün çalışacak, sadece o buton herhangi bir işlem yaratmayacak. Böyle bir yaklaşım, program belirleme sürecinde büyük esneklik sağlar.

Sanal klavyenin tüm görüntüleri (ikonları) RAM'e yüklenir ve seçilen düğme ölçeğine (Parametre 56) ve seçili olan sembol penceresine (Parametre 173) göre oluşturulur. Bir klavye yüksek miktarda düğme veya ağır görüntü dosyası içerdiğinde, bu işleme işlemi çok zaman alabilir. Programın ayarlar penceresindeki her değişiklik, yeni profil yükleme veya değişikliklerden sonra yeniden işleme tamamlanır. ECTkeyboard ana pencere boyutu. Klavye efektlerinin her bir durumu kendi görüntüsüne sahip olduğunda veya bu görüntüler yüksek çözünürlüğe sahipse, bu efekt daha belirgindir. Bu nedenle, programın sadece PRO sürümü klavye simgelerini destekler, çünkü kullanıcının programda kullanılan tüm parametreleri ve ayarları tam olarak anlaması gerekir.

Klavye simgelerinin aksine, ses dosyaları duyuru anındaki depolama aygıtından yüklenir. Programın hızını arttırmak için, bir sabit sürücüden veya herhangi bir hızlı harici depolama cihazından (USB 2.0 veya 3.0) başlatılması önerilir. Kullanıcı başlattığında ECTkeyboard USB 1.0 portu ile bağlanan bir depolama cihazından veya böyle bir cihazın okuma hızı çok düşük olduğundan, programın maksimum verimi ve çalışma hızını sağlamayacak şekilde programın sesleri gecikmeli olarak çalınabilir.

Geçerli klavye dosyası yapısı, kullanıcının örneğin ek parametreler eklemesini sağlar. yeni yerelleştirmeler, çok çabuk (bkz. şekil 26). Ek bir yerelleştirmeyle çalışmak için, kullanıcının programın ayarlar penceresindeki 28 parametresinin değerini sadece 5 1., çünkü klavye dosyasının beşinci sütununa ek başlıklar eklenir. Bir klavye dosyasında, farklı sütunlarla kaydedilmiş farklı yerelleştirmeler olabilir. # ayırıcı. Gerekirse, kullanıcı ayrıca klavye için belirli ses grupları veya simgeler ekleyebilir. Bu işlemin inanılmaz kolaylığı yapar ECTkeyboard gerçekten evrensel bir program.

Adding localization to the keyboard file (Şek. 26. Klavye dosyasına yerelleştirme ekleme)